Title: Akemi Yamamoto: Innovator in Women's Apparel
Introduction
Akemi Yamamoto is a notable inventor based in Kyoto,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of women's apparel, particularly in the design of innovative brassieres. With a total of 2 patents to his name, Yamamoto continues to push the boundaries of fashion technology.
Latest Patents
Yamamoto's latest patent focuses on a unique brassiere design that enhances comfort and support for women. This innovative approach addresses common issues faced by wearers, making it a valuable addition to the market.
Career Highlights
Yamamoto is currently employed at Wacoal Corporation, a leading company in women's lingerie. His work at Wacoal has allowed him to collaborate with other talented individuals in the industry, further enhancing his expertise and influence.
